How To Stake Peas – Information On Supporting Pea Plants
When your vining type peas begin to show growth, it's time to think about staking peas in the garden. Place stakes every few feet behind your peas and string a sturdy cotton twine along the middle and tops of the stakes.

What Are Pea Weevils: Information For Control Of Pea Weevil Pests
If so, the culprits are very likely pea weevil pests. Spent vines should be pulled and destroyed immediately post-harvest. This practice will prevent any eggs deposited from hatching or developing and infesting the pea crop the following year.
